How Common Is The Last Name Smith-Harris?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 3,100,440th most commonly occurring family name world-wide, held by around 1 in 182,188,648 people. The surname Smith-Harris occ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 98 percent of Smith-Harris reside; 90 percent reside in North America and 90 percent reside in Anglo-North America.

The last name is most commonly held in The United States, where it is borne by 36 people, or 1 in 10,068,304. In The United States Smith-Harris is most prevalent in: New York, where 25 percent reside, California, where 22 percent reside and Illinois, where 6 percent reside. Excluding The United States this last name is found in 3 countries. It is also found in Jamaica, where 5 percent reside and England, where 3 percent reside.
